ESP32 IOT SmartHome Kit Logo

Contents

  • Introduction
    • Bill of Materials
    • Function Display
    • Video Tutorial
  • Smart Home Assembly Tutorial
    • Installation video tutorial
    • Wiring
    • Screw size comparison
    • 1.Installation of base part
      • Step 1: Install the ESP32 development board
      • Step 2: Install the battery box
      • Step 3: Install the base
    • 2.Installation of the first floor
      • Step 1: Install the button module
      • Step 2: Install LCD screen
      • Step 3: First floor assembly
    • 3.Installation of the second floor
      • Step 1: Install window
        • Step 1-1: Install of gear and swing arm
        • Step 1-2: Install the window servo on the basswood board
        • Step 1-3: Install the window gear and acrylic plate onto the basswood board
      • Step 2: Install of the Motor Fan
      • Step 3: Install the Solar Charging Panel
      • Step 4: Install of the Sensor Module
      • Step 5: Second floor assembly
      • Step 6: Install roof
      • Step 7: Install of the Second Fence
    • 4.Installation of the garden
      • Step 1: Install of the gate
        • Step 1-1: Install of gear and swing arm
        • Step 1-2: Install the gate servo on the basswood board
        • Step 1-3: Install the gate gear and acrylic plate onto the basswood board
        • Step 1-4: Install of RFID sensor module
        • Steps 1-5: Install the gate to the garden
      • Step 2: Install the speech recognition module
      • Step 3: Install of LED Light Module
      • Step 4: Install flowers and trees in the garden
      • Step 5: Install the RGB Light Strip
      • Step 6: Install of the Garden Fence
    • 5.Installation of the fixed part of the cabin
      • Step 1: Attach the base
      • Step 2: Install the windmill blades
      • Step 3: Install the debug window cover
  • Arduino IDE Getting Started Tutorial
    • 1.Install the Arduino IDE
      • Install Arduino IDE on Windows
      • Install Arduino IDE on MacOS
      • Install Arduino IDE on Linux
      • Open the Arduino IDE
    • 2.Install CH340 Driver
      • Download the Driver
      • Install the Driver
      • Checking Correct Driver Installation in Device Manager
      • Checking Correct Driver Installation in Arduino IDE
    • 3.Install The ESP32 Core Board
      • Add Additional Boards Manager URL
      • Download the ESP32 Core Package
    • 4.Add Libraries
      • Download Libraries
      • Import Libraries
      • Download Libraries Using Arduino IDE
  • Upload Code To ESP32
    • Option 1:Use Arduino IDE to burn the program
      • Download the Code
      • Select a Development Board
      • Select the Serial Port
      • Check Board and Port Selection
      • Upload Code
    • Option 2:Direct Burn Program
      • Install CH340 Driver
      • Download burning tools
      • Burn firmware
  • Multiple Control Options
    • Automatic Control
    • App control
    • Speech Recognition control
  • The Kit Course Learning
    • Course 1:LED Module-Breathing Light
    • Course 2:Light Sensor-Brightness Detection
    • Course 3:PIR Sensor-Human Body Detection
    • Course 4:Raindrop Sensor-Raindrop Detection
    • Course 5:DHT11 Sensor+Fan Module-Temperature controlled fan
    • Course 6:LCD1602 Screen-Environmental Status Display
    • Course 7:RFID Module+SG90 Servo-Card access control system
    • Course 8:Button Module+RGB Light Strip-Ambient Lighting
    • Course 9:Speech Recognition Module-Voice-Controlled Light
  • Frequently Asked Questions
ESP32 IOT SmartHome Kit
  • ESP32 IOT SmartHome Kit
  • View page source

ESP32 IOT SmartHome Kit

Contents

  • Introduction
    • Bill of Materials
    • Function Display
    • Video Tutorial
  • Smart Home Assembly Tutorial
    • Installation video tutorial
    • Wiring
    • Screw size comparison
    • 1.Installation of base part
    • 2.Installation of the first floor
    • 3.Installation of the second floor
    • 4.Installation of the garden
    • 5.Installation of the fixed part of the cabin
  • Arduino IDE Getting Started Tutorial
    • 1.Install the Arduino IDE
    • 2.Install CH340 Driver
    • 3.Install The ESP32 Core Board
    • 4.Add Libraries
  • Upload Code To ESP32
    • Option 1:Use Arduino IDE to burn the program
    • Option 2:Direct Burn Program
  • Multiple Control Options
    • Automatic Control
    • App control
    • Speech Recognition control
  • The Kit Course Learning
    • Course 1:LED Module-Breathing Light
    • Course 2:Light Sensor-Brightness Detection
    • Course 3:PIR Sensor-Human Body Detection
    • Course 4:Raindrop Sensor-Raindrop Detection
    • Course 5:DHT11 Sensor+Fan Module-Temperature controlled fan
    • Course 6:LCD1602 Screen-Environmental Status Display
    • Course 7:RFID Module+SG90 Servo-Card access control system
    • Course 8:Button Module+RGB Light Strip-Ambient Lighting
    • Course 9:Speech Recognition Module-Voice-Controlled Light
  • Frequently Asked Questions
Next

© Copyright 2025, Lafvin.

Built with Sphinx using a theme provided by Read the Docs.